Rob Canning exits TEN

TEN News Sports Presenter Rob Canning is the latest name added to the long list of employees to be departing.

Canning has been with the network since 2000 and was announced as a part of the weekend News at Five presenting team at the end of last year.

He was Sports Tonight‘s youngest ever presenter when anchoring the show in 2003 at the age of 22.

A TEN spokesperson told the Sydney Morning Herald, “As a result of the changes to the News and Operations department Rob Canning will be leaving TEN.

“Rob has been with TEN for several years and most recently has presented the sport on TEN’s Weekend News bulletin.

“He is a highly regarded presenter and reporter and we wish him the very best for the future.”
